Instrumentation is a component of measurement that involves the application of specific rules to develop a measurement device or instrument (Groves, Burns, & Gray, 2013) . Instruments are used to measure specific variables in a study. Data gathered with an instrument are at the nominal, ordinal, interval or ratio level of measurement with nominal as the lowest and ratio the highest (Groves et al., 2013) .

Selection of an instrument requires extensive examination of reliability and validity. Methodologic studies address the development, validation and evaluation of research tools (Polit& Beck, 2010) . Instrument development research often involves complex and sophisticated research methods including the use of mixed method designs.

An instrument is a formal written document used to collect self-reported data.

In drafting questions for a structured instrument researchers must carefully monitor the wording of each question for clarity, sensitivity to respondent's psychological state, absence of bias and reading level for questionnaires (Polit& Beck, 2010) .

Draft instruments are critically reviewed by peers or colleagues and then pretested with a small sample of respondents. A pretest is used to determine if the instrument is useful in generating desired information and the process can take many months to complete.
